Yeah, products like Cortaid are made specifically for rashes, eczema, the like.

As for Vaseline, the only ingredient is petrolatum, which is molecularly too large to clog your pores. Topical application of petrolatum can help the skins outer layer recover from damage, reduce inflammation, and generally heal the skin (Source: Acta Dermato-Venereologica, NovemberDecember 2000, pages 412415).

What can happen, however, (this is my theory, anyway, as I have noticed an increase in blocked pores after long term use of Aquaphor) is that it blocks your skin's oil from exiting the the pore easily. Leading to a bit of a backup. So if you have super oily skin to begin with (like me), then you might get some blocked pores as a result. But, it does work wonders with dry/damaged skin. Aquaphor is basically Vaseline on steroids. It's petrolatum with other moisturizing ingredients, so it is more nourishing than just plain old Vaseline.
